I'm not sure this alternative will work: if you have a custom recovery on your phone, you can use it to backup only your "Boot" and "System" partitions, then restore the backup. I recommend you flash your phone's stock ROM to fix the bootloop. Therefore, SuperSUMe might be working in June (for an old version of KingRoot) when posted this thread, but not anymore. They said they had to block SuperSUMe from successfully removing the latest version of KingRoot because it used to remove both KingRoot and their Purify app (which they said has nothing to do with rooting process).
